Managing Stumps and Origins: Options for Removal



When you have actually evaluated the aftermath of the tree removal, you'll likely need to take on the stump and origins left behind.

You have a couple of options for elimination. One efficient approach is stump grinding, where a specialist uses a maker to grind the stump down to below ground level. This approach leaves marginal disruption to your landscape.

If you prefer a do it yourself technique, you can use a mix of excavating and chemical stump removers. Just remember, this process can take some time and effort.

Alternatively, consider leaving the stump as an all-natural feature, which can serve as a distinct yard component or environment for wildlife.

Whatever you select, dealing with the stump and origins is necessary for recovering your landscape.

Selecting the Right Plants for Your New Room



As you analyze your freshly gotten rid of space, choosing the right plants can dramatically improve your landscape's beauty and capability.

Begin by taking into consideration the sunlight and soil problems. For bright locations, go with drought-resistant plants like lavender or succulents. In shaded spots, brushes and hostas flourish well.

Think of the dimension and development routines of your plants; mix perennials and annuals for seasonal selection. Do not forget to integrate indigenous species; they require less upkeep and support neighborhood wild animals.

Group plants in strange numbers for a more natural look and create layers for visual depth.

Ultimately, guarantee you have a mix of colors and appearances to keep your landscape lively throughout the periods.
